Transaction fd66de4b23cfc3ec85dbdaa711c5ff7c5739f3b5c53e396b193b0e12e10b3191
1 Input
2 Outputs
- fd66de4b23cfc3ec85dbdaa711c5ff7c5739f3b5c53e396b193b0e12e10b3191:0
- fd66de4b23cfc3ec85dbdaa711c5ff7c5739f3b5c53e396b193b0e12e10b3191:1
value 551583
address 1M1GQcTrryvwQrcn1G4iar1TwLXShfSZBp
value 564879
address 1K2kWKfbJsGtmQ6bR7FvW34K127sBKrCEc